Squiddy wrote:2680 seen on a 998 this morning

So now the 25xx and 26xx series are pretty close to completion. What happens after that? Does Swan get 28xx and Transdev 29xx? If that's the case then what happens when Path's 2799 is delivered, since 30xx-31xx is taken by artics?

The contract to supply 70 new Volvo Artic 'B8BRLEA' buses is nearly complete with 3097, 3098, 3099, 3100, 3101 and 3102 left to go. I'd say 3103+ will be for new rigids going to Path Transit.
